What is Customer Orientation?

Customer orientation is a mindset that revolves around organizing your entire business based on the demands and preferences of your customers. It involves aligning processes, staff training, and product development to effectively respond to consumer behavior.

This approach contrasts with sales orientation, which prioritizes the interests of the business, or product orientation, which focuses on creating superior products.

While related disciplines like customer experience management (CXM or CX) often intersect with this concept, it’s important to note that CX serves as the means through which customer orientation is realized.

Being customer-oriented represents the overarching philosophy guiding the organization. And this should be your approach while creating your eCommerce website.

Steps to Create a Customer-Oriented eCommerce Website

When building your eCommerce website, it’s crucial to empathize with your customers and consider the questions and concerns they may have.

Your website design should proactively address these queries and provide solutions. The goal is to ensure that customers can quickly find their desired items, access comprehensive information, and effortlessly place their orders.

Undoubtedly, achieving this level of customer-friendliness may seem challenging, but there are effective ways to do it.

Let’s explore a few approaches that can assist you in crafting a more user-centric eCommerce website:

  1. Understand Your Ideal Customer Profile
  2. Map the Customer Journey
  3. Understand Your Technology Needs
  4. Choose the Right Platforms
  5. Prioritize Omnichannel CX
  6. Don’t Compromise with Security
  7. Plan Your Site Structure
  8. Design a Responsive Layout
  9. Enable User Ratings and Reviews
  10. Simplify the Checkout Process
  11. Offer Personalized Product Recommendations
